Sweden's population reached 9.5 million yesterday
Friday, 04 May 2012
Swedish population has reached 9.5 million inhabitants and the milestone was passed yesterday according to reports from statistic Sweden.
Today's increase in population constitutes two thirds of increased immigration. Person number 9.5 millionth was likely an immigrant, writes Statistics Sweden, SCB.
Since 12 August 2004, when Sweden passed the 9 million mark, the annual population growth has varied between 36 000 and 84 000 people. The fastest rise from million to million was made between 1950 and 1969 when the population rose from 7 to 8 million. The increase took 19 years.
Within a decade, the population is estimated to reach 10 million. That is now it is expected that by 2021 Sweden expects that its population will reach 10 million.
If so, this increase from million to million will become the fastest that has occurred in Swedish history.
